Why a Cal king
Lampropeltis californiae is one of the best first snakes there is. They're hardy, they feed reliably, they stay a manageable 3–4 feet, and they live 15–20 years. A 20–30 gallon enclosure suits an adult, and they eat appropriately sized frozen-thawed mice their whole life.
One rule with kingsnakes: house them singly. The name comes from the fact that they eat other snakes, and that instinct doesn't switch off in captivity.
